Henri Fantin-Latour's "Portrait of Manet" (1867) is a striking black and white drawing that captures the essence of the renowned Impressionist painter, Édouard Manet. The intimate portrait showcases Manet's distinctive features, including his thick beard and piercing gaze, rendered with meticulous detail using pen and ink. Fantin-Latour's skillful use of hatching and cross-hatching creates a sense of depth and texture, enhancing the realism of the portrait. This drawing, measuring 30 x 25 cm, is a testament to the artistic talent of both Fantin-Latour and his subject, Manet.
